## Local setup

Skewatch detects clock skew between build agents. Run `skewatch agent --local` on each simulated node; the coordinator compares reported timestamps against its monotonic reference. Tolerance defaults to 250ms. Audit-relevant: all skew observations are persisted with signed agent identities, and tampering with the offset table invalidates attestation. Schema is append-only; no deletes permitted. Apply migrations with `skewatch db up` first. The coordinator stores observations using the connection string below.

replica DSN, kajep-yahag: mssql://praok_svc:iF@db-8d68.plorvaio.local:5432/eliion

**Mgmt Meeting Minutes — Retiring the Brightline Range**

Quick recap for sales leads at Fenholt Supplies: we agreed to retire the Brightline fixture range by year-end. Remaining stock moves to clearance pricing next month, and accounts on standing orders get migrated to the Lumetta range. Trade-in incentives were approved in principle. The confidential note on next steps sits just below.

board note of bajof-bajeg: The pricing group signed off on a budget of $13.4 million for Project Sildor. The renewal with Lamixek Holdings closes at $48.9 million a year, 49 percent above the last contract.

# Lanternfish Checkout — Environments

Three envs: dev, perf, prod. Load tests run against perf only. Perf mirrors prod topology but with synthetic payment stubs from Mockvault, so no settlement calls leave the cluster.

During checkout load tests, expect elevated latency on the cart-merge step; that's known. If perf falls over, restart the order-intake pods first, then the pricing cache. Do not point load generators at prod — rate limiting there is stricter and you'll page everyone.

Current perf environment settings are as follows.

settings of bafof-fajog:
[aldix]
port = 9300
region = north-3
host = aldix.kelvilabs.example
team = istath
timeout_ms = 1500
retries = 8

FAQ — Visitor handling, Brackmere Foyer

All visitors sign in at the front desk. Issue a day pass, confirm the host by phone, and escort visitors past the turnstiles — no exceptions. Lost day passes: log immediately and deactivate. Deliveries are not visitors; send them to goods-in. After 18:00, visitors wait in the foyer until collected. If the turnstile reader rejects a freshly issued pass, override it at the desk panel using the code below.

staff pass of kawip-hawef = bdg-QLP-2